Sadly, these heroes sometimes give the ultimate sacrifice in the line of duty and never come home. In honor of the final chapter of one hero's story, we want to celebrate the life and service of Capt. Michael Scott Speicher.

Speicher grew up in the Northland and attended Lakewood, Eastgate and Winnetonka before moving to Florida at the age of 15. He graduated from high school in Jacksonville, then Florida State University, and eventually joined the Navy, becoming a fighter pilot. Despite the distance, he sustained many of his childhood friendships that began here in the Northland.
